Top 5 Reasons to Market Your Business on Pinterest

pinterest-icon_logo.jpg

The key to social media success is to understand the platforms that best sync with your business. You must first be aware of the different platforms available, the benefits of each, and how you can leverage these benefits to promote your business online.

With more than 70 million users around the world (Semiocast), Pinterest is one such platform that can help boost your business in more ways than one. So, why exactly should you market your business on Pinterest? Here are five great reasons.

1. Build Trust & Loyalty: Every online business owner understands the value of gaining trust on the Internet. It would mean quicker conversions, better brand recognition and even positive referrals. When you upload pictures on your website or blog and ask people to ‘pin’ your photographs, you are instantly connecting with the online world. Showcasing your business offerings will help potential buyers to develop a better understanding of what you’re selling. By pinning relevant and helpful resources, you will attract followers, increase your authority, and build the trust of your followers, which can lead to increased customer loyalty and positive referrals.

2. Increase Brand Visibility & Website Traffic: More than 80% of pins are repins (source: RJMetrics) which means it is very likely that your potential customer will pin your product images to their wall, resulting in increased brand visibility. According to a Pinterest study, 69% of Pinterest users have found at least one item that they bought or were interested in buying.

3. Promote Your Products/Services: Pinterest allows you to include a text description with every pin you post. You can leverage that space to promote your product and/or service offerings or explain to users how that given pin can relate to a person’s personal interest. By doing so, the likelihood of a user repining your pin on their own board will increase.

You can use your Pinterest board as an advertising canvas for a promotional offer, a brand message or even a product launch. Utilising this feature could be vital for the growth of your business.

4. Leverage Third Party Tool to Increase Your Pinterest ROI: There are many third party Pinterest tools that can help you enhance your social media marketing experience. These resources could help you in many ways, from understanding live trends to even editing tools. An example of a few Pinterest tools include:

– Piqora: a powerful marketing and analytical suite that monitors how your pins and boards are performing.

– Pin Alerts: is a real-time Pinterest monitoring system that will send you automatic notifications every time someone pins something from your website.

– Pinstamatic: allows you to create custom pin-able links for your Pinterest board. This tool can turn locations, music, quotes, calendar dates, Twitter profile links, sticky notes and websites into pinnable links for others to share.

5. Reach Targeted Audiences: Pinterest allows people with shared interests to connect and share content with one another. You can leverage this activity by targeting niche audiences who can relate to your products and/or services. Use images that you know your target audience would “like”, share, or comment on. At the same time make sure you use relevant keywords. By using the correct keywords for your business, it is likely you’ll receive more shares by bloggers, a vital aspect for your company website.
